

body{
margin:0px;
padding: 0px;
color:#333;
font-family: arial;
font-size:12px;
background-color: #f5f5f5;

}




a:link    { color:#3f51b5; text-decoration:none; }
a:visited { color:#3f51b5; text-decoration:none; }
a:hover   { color:#1a237e; text-decoration:underline; }

.blue{
	color: #002F7B;
}






h1,
h2,
h3
{
	margin: 0px;
	padding: 0px;
	padding-bottom: 20px;
	line-height: 120%;

}



.i100{
	width: 100% !important;
	box-sizing: border-box;
}





.login-box0{
	display: block;
	text-align: center;
}


.login-box{
	display: inline-block;
	text-align: left;
	width: 400px;
	background-color: #fff;
	margin-top: 50px;
	border-radius: 4px;
	box-shadow: 0px 4px 8px rgba(0,0,0,0.1);
	box-sizing: border-box;
}

.login-logo{
	display: block;
	text-align: center;
	background-color: #002F7B;
	padding: 50px 0px;
}

.login-logo img{
	height: 80px;
	max-width: 100%;
}


.login-form{
	display: block;
	padding: 30px;
}

.f{
	display: block;
	padding-bottom: 25px;

}

.f-l{
	display: block;
	padding-bottom: 5px;

}

.f-i{
	display: block;
}


.f-h{
	display: block;
	color: #999;
	font-style: italic;
	padding-top: 5px;

}




.title{
	font-size:16px;
	font-weight:bold;
}






.goyotable{
	border-top: #ccc 1px solid;
	border-left: #ccc 1px solid;
	border-spacing: 0px;
}

.goyotable td{
	border-bottom: #ccc 1px solid;
	border-right: #ccc 1px solid;
	background-color: #fff;
	padding: 7px 10px;
}
.th td{
	font-weight: bold;
	text-align: center;
	background-color: #999;
	color: #fff;
}



.box{
	display: block;
	padding: 30px;
	box-sizing: border-box;
	margin-bottom: 30px;
	background-color: #fff;

}





.zaavals{
	display: inline-block;
	vertical-align: top;
	margin-left: 4px;
	color: red;
	font-weight: bold;
	font-size: 15px;
}





.input{
color:#000;
font-family: arial;
font-size:13px;
padding: 10px 15px;
border:#ccc 1px solid;
-webkit-border-radius: 3px;
-moz-border-radius: 3px;
border-radius: 3px;
box-sizing: border-box;
max-width: 100%;
cursor: pointer;
}



.select{
	position: relative;
	z-index: 0;
	display: inline-block;
	vertical-align: top;

}


.select::after{
content: "\f107";
font-family: 'FontAwesome';
font-size: 16px;
color: #333;
position: absolute;
right: 10px;
top: 50%;
transform: translateY(-50%);
z-index: 2;

}


.select select{

-webkit-appearance:none;
appearance:none;
font-family: Arial, Helvetica, sans-serif;
font-size: 13px;
color: #000;
background-color: #fff;
padding: 10px 15px;
padding-right: 25px;
border: #ccc 1px solid;
box-sizing: border-box;
border-radius: 3px;
outline: none;
vertical-align: top;
width: 100%;


}



.button{
	
-webkit-appearance:none;
appearance:none;
display: inline-block;
text-decoration: none !important;
color: #fff !important;
padding: 10px 15px;
background-color: #999;
-webkit-border-radius: 3px;
-moz-border-radius: 3px;
border-radius: 3px;
box-shadow: 1px 1px 2px rgba(0,0,0,0.1);
border: none;
box-sizing: border-box;
cursor: pointer;
margin:0px;
font-size: 14px;
font-weight: bold;
outline: none;

}

.button:hover{
	background-color: #666;
}

.button i{
	display: inline-block;
	margin-right: 3px;
}


.button-green{
	background-color: #2e7d32;

}
.button-green:hover{
	background-color: #216825;
}


.button-red{
	background-color: #f44336;

}
.button-red:hover{
	background-color: #dd372b;
}


.button-blue{
	background-color: #30549e;

}
.button-blue:hover{
	background-color: #284889;
}


.button-orange{
	background-color: #ff9800;

}
.button-orange:hover{
	background-color: #e28700;
}


.button-indigo{
	background-color: #3f51b5;

}
.button-indigo:hover{
	background-color: #1a237e;
}


.button-mini{
	padding: 4px 10px;
	font-size: 12px;
}

.button-big{
	padding: 12px 20px;
	font-size: 16px;
}


.spacer{
	display: block;
	height: 20px;
}





.buttons-line{
	display: block;
	box-sizing: border-box;
	padding-bottom: 30px;
}

.search-sec{
	display: block;
	box-sizing: border-box;
	padding-bottom: 30px;

}



.cols-bg{
	display: block;
	text-align: center;

}



.col2-1{
	display: inline-block;
	vertical-align: top;
	width: 50%;
	box-sizing: border-box;
	padding-right: 15px;
}

.col2-2{
	display: inline-block;
	vertical-align: top;
	width: 50%;
	box-sizing: border-box;
	padding-left: 15px;

}

.col-single{
	display: inline-block;
	vertical-align: top;
	width: 800px;
	text-align: left;

}


.divbox{
	display: block;
	background-color: #fff;
	padding: 20px 25px;
	box-shadow: 0px 0px 1px rgba(0,0,0,0.2);
	margin-bottom: 20px;
}

.mainbody{
	display: block;
	padding: 20px 25px;
}


.ok,
.error,
.tips{
	display: block;
	padding: 8px 12px;
	margin-bottom: 20px;
	-webkit-border-radius: 3px;
	-moz-border-radius: 3px;
	border-radius: 3px;
	font-weight: bold;
}

.ok{
	color: #2e7d32;
	border: #2e7d32  1px solid;
	background-color: #e8f5e9;
}

.error{
	color: #f44336;
	border: #f44336  1px solid;
	background-color: #ffebee;
}

.tips{
	color: #f9a825;
	border: #fdd835  1px solid;
	background-color: #fffde7;
}


.empty{
	display: block;
	padding: 50px 0px;
	font-style: italic;
	color: #999;
	text-align: center;
}


.paging{
	display: block;
	text-align: center;
	font-size: 0px;
	padding: 10px 0px;
}

.paging div{
    font-size: 12px;
    padding-bottom: 15px;
}

.paging a{
	font-size: 12px;
	display: inline-block;
	-webkit-border-radius: 35px;
	-moz-border-radius: 35px;
	border-radius: 35px;
	padding: 7px 12px;
	margin-right: 4px;
	background-color: #ccc;
	color: #000;
	text-decoration: none;
}

.paging a:hover{
	background-color: #2e7d32;
	color: #fff;
	}

a.paging-active{
	background-color: #2e7d32;
	color: #fff;
}


.leftside{
	display: block;
	position: fixed;
	left: 0px;
	top: 0px;
	height: 100%;
	width: 250px;
	background-color: #151946;
	overflow-y: auto; 



}

.leftlogo{
	display: block;
	text-align: center;
	padding: 30px 0px;
}

.leftlogo img{
	height: 50px;

}

.lefttopmenu{
	display: block;
	text-align: center;
	padding-bottom: 15px;
}

.mainside{
	display: block;
	width: 100%;
	box-sizing: border-box;
	padding-left: 250px;


}

.leftmenuc{
	display: block;
	color: #fff;
	text-decoration: none;
	padding: 15px 17px;
	padding-bottom: 5px;
	text-transform: uppercase;
	font-weight: bold;
	font-size: 15px;
	border-top: rgba(255,255,255,0.1) 1px solid;
}



.leftmenui a{
	display: block;
	color: #fff;
	text-decoration: none;
	padding: 12px 15px;
	position: relative;
	box-sizing: border-box;
	padding-left: 45px;
}


.leftmenui a:hover{
	color: #ffc107;
	background-color: rgba(255,255,255,0.1);
}


.leftmenui a i{
	display: inline-block;
	position: absolute;
	top: 50%;
	left: 15px;
	transform: translateY(-50%);
	font-size: 15px;
	font-weight: normal;
}

.leftmenui a span{
	display: inline-block;
	position: absolute;
	top: 50%;
	right: 15px;
	background-color: orange;
	color: #fff;
	font-size: 10px;
	padding: 3px 5px;
	-webkit-border-radius: 10px;
	-moz-border-radius: 10px;
	border-radius: 10px;
	transform: translateY(-50%);
}

.leftmenubg{
	padding-bottom: 15px;
	padding-top: 5px;
}



.lefttopmenu a{
	display: inline-block;
	color: #fff;
	text-decoration: none;
	padding: 0px 10px;
}


.lefttopmenu a:hover{

	color: #ffc107;
}

.lefttopmenu a i{
	font-size: 15px;
}



.googlemapselect{
	display: block;
	height: 400px;
}



.tabs{
	display: block;
	border-bottom: #ccc 1px solid;
	margin-bottom: 30px;
}


.tabs a{
	display: inline-block;
	vertical-align: top;
	padding: 10px 20px;
	background-color: #ccc;
	text-decoration: none;
	margin-right: 4px;
	color: #000;
	font-weight: bold;
}

.tabs a.active{

	background-color: #12277d !important;
	color: #fff !important;

}



.hide{
	display: none;
}




.col60{
	display: inline-block;
	vertical-align: top;
	width: calc(100% - 300px);
	box-sizing: border-box;
	padding-right: 20px;
}

.col40{
	display: inline-block;
	vertical-align: top;
	width: 300px;
	box-sizing: border-box;
	padding-left: 20px;
}


















